| A | B | C | D | E | F | G | H | I | |
|---|---|---|---|---|---|---|---|---|---|
1 | |||||||||
2 | |||||||||
3 | OCA functional group - Sets of modules | ||||||||
4 | |||||||||
5 | Current team | ||||||||
6 | Yann Le Moing | ||||||||
7 | Charline Dumontet | ||||||||
8 | Quentin Lavallée | ||||||||
9 | Benedito Monteiro | ||||||||
10 | Elodie Lestrat | ||||||||
11 | Jussi Lehto | ||||||||
12 | |||||||||
13 | |||||||||
14 | Thoughts/Ideas | ||||||||
15 | |||||||||
16 | Short term (Q2 2023) | ||||||||
17 | First layer with base and module per process and then another layer by industry for instance | ||||||||
18 | Start on 15 (Because not all the OCA modules are migrated in V16 yet) | ||||||||
19 | How can we give visibility to this list: | ||||||||
20 | Github -> Short term (can be done more easily) | ||||||||
21 | Using the Readme to list it | ||||||||
22 | Numigi used a “shell” module with a readme with the list and all the dependencies listed in the manifest to automate the installation -> Good way to follow the migration and the upgrade of the module | ||||||||
23 | Shop -> Maybe not easy to do, need to be checked with Virginie | ||||||||
24 | List of packs per version | ||||||||
25 | Start here page with the list | ||||||||
26 | |||||||||
27 | Longer term (OCA Days) | ||||||||
28 | The final goal is to have something more user oriented: | ||||||||
29 | For example: I have a company using e-commerce, which modules should I install? Etc… | ||||||||
30 | But we will start with easier sets to test the methodology/the way to do | ||||||||
31 | How can we maintain this list? | ||||||||
32 | Needs to be updated for each Odoo version: separate list by each version? | ||||||||
33 | Plan regular “automatic” migrations - cost sharing for a migration relatively early in new versions because they are “core” modules - for increased availability | ||||||||
34 | |||||||||
35 | Possible starting materials | ||||||||
36 | C2C has a migration analysis file where we count the most installed modules | ||||||||
37 | Quentin has already defined must have modules in his company | ||||||||
38 | Benedito gives a “rate” on the modules regarding the usage | ||||||||
39 | (i) On the OCA shop, we can see the number of downloads for each modules | ||||||||
40 | |||||||||
41 | |||||||||